New Delhi, June 01, 2025 (ANI): Speaking to ANI on President Trump’s statement claiming the credits of brokered India and Pakistan ceasefire, Congress MP Jai Ram Ramesh questions Prime Minister Modi for not speaking on this issue. He also said that he made a count of President Trumps repeating the same point 11 times for 21 days. He said, "I made a count, President Trump has repeated the same point he has been making for 21 days. He has claimed to have mediated and brokered the ceasefire, the new thing he has said is about nuclear escalation. He has reiterated his trade and tariffs threat as well... Secretary of State Marco Rubio, VP Vance, and even their Trade Secretary have said this... Our Prime Minister is silent. He has not responded to what President Trump has been saying. He is targeting the Congress party when he should be targeting Pakistan. He should be making sure that the perpetrators of the Pahalgam terror attack are caught and killed... The Congress has demanded, advocated, and championed unity and solidarity at this moment of great crisis, beginning April 22, and we have extended our full support to the government. All we asked was for the Prime Minister to chair an all-party meeting and call for a session of the Parliament. Revelations made by Gen Chauhan yesterday in Singapore make our demand even more relevant now... The outcome of the Parliament session should be a resolution, which reiterates the resolution of February 22, 1994, on PoK and brings in new elements..."
